2004 London Double Header

The London Double Header began in 2004 and opens what was the Zurich Premiership and is now the Guinness Premiership. The Guinness Premiership is the top rugby union league in England.

Two games are played consecutively, involving four teams. The matches are allocated as a home game for one team in each match.

The four teams involved were Saracens, Wasps, Harlequins and London Irish.

The matches were played on Saturday 4th September 2004, to a crowd of 51000 people. London Irish beat Harlequins 18 -12 and Saracens beat Wasps 13-21.
